If you compare now and your early years of your career are there any differences between your ideas about the description of being an actress?
Actually I don't have that much definitions. I've chosen to be an actress because I'm happy at the stage and I love playing!
I didn't have any ambitions to be famous or to be known at the beginning. Let me tell you truth: I was in Venice Film Festival in 1987 with the movie "Anayurt Oteli". I was one of the leading actresses who were competing in such an international film festival at that year. At that moment I told to myself “I couldn't imagine such kind of things”. How weird, I just wanted to be an actress. Somehow in cinema, I've never thought of being famous or a celebrity.
So there was only theatre in the beginning?
Absolutely, it was the only thing on my mind. I don't know why but I've never thought of TV and cinema. However, I grew up in a house where my father was a film critic and he was also the founding president of the Cinematheque, I've grown up with cinema. I don't know exactly but maybe theatre was accessible for me. Anyway I'm fine with cinema right now. Being part of a film set and acting in a film is gorgeous for me. For instance for last two years I've been working at the film set at my birthdays. This is great for me. I hope it will be same again next year. I love the job itself.
People can discuss whether I played well or not. It doesn't matter because they'll never agree with that. Some of them will like and the other ones will not, this is normal. But I know that I touch their feelings, I realized that from their eyes and hearts...

Do you pay attention of being loved by people?
Do you think anybody who doesn’t care about this can be a performer?
There are few psychoanalytic aspects of this job. One of them is exhibitionism. So because I'm exhibiting at the stage or in front of the camera this satisfies me enough. In private life I don't prefer this. The other one is resisting in childhood. Who plays? Children! Acting is childish. That's ironic... You know players, actors, performers are people who can't farewell to childhood. And the last one is of course, desire for being admired. Why do you act? Because you wanna be appreciated. Some actors deny this. When they say "Come on, don't keep on me!" actually they want it! I want them to be honest, please.
